Common Issues with Legacy Laptops

Hardware Problems

CPUs and RAM among other parts of laptops age naturally over time. Reduced performance and higher hardware failure risk can follow from this degradation. Extending the life of the laptop depends critically on regular maintenance and timely component replacements.

Older laptops have shorter usage hours and more frequent charging since their battery life decreases with aging. Users may find that their battery performs poorly; in such cases, a replacement battery could be required to restore portability and complete operation.

Data loss and mechanical breakdowns are more likely on hard drives found in outdated computers. Slower performance, regular crashes, and corrupted files define a failing hard disk. Changing or upgrading the hard disk will help to fix problems and raise system dependability.

Software Issues

Older running systems seen in legacy laptops sometimes lack security fixes or updates. This can restrict the compatibility with more recent software programs and expose the system to security flaws. Operating system updates or upgrades help to reduce these hazards.

Compatibility problems with new software programs could cause them to not run on older technology. This can limit the usability of contemporary apps and features, therefore influencing the general laptop performance and functionality.

Older computers with obsolete software are more vulnerable to security concerns. Regular upgrades help to prevent malware infections and data breaches from occurring in these systems, so quick resolution of security problems is crucial.

Tools and Equipment Needed

Essential Tools for Hardware Repair

Disassembling computers and access to internal components depend on precision screwdrivers. To handle different screws and pieces, they come in several diameters and shapes. Using the right screwdriver guarantees correct and safe performance of repairs.

Anti-static bracelets shield delicate electronic components against static energy. Wearing one helps to avoid electrostatic discharge, which may permanently damage internal components during repairs. Successful repairs depend on this basic but vital step.

Thermal paste improves CPU heat transfer to its cooling system. Correct application of thermal paste helps maintain ideal operating temperatures and prevents overheating, which can influence the performance and lifetime of the laptop.

Software Tools for Diagnosis and Repair

Diagnostic Software

Hardware and software problems are found and fixed using diagnostic programs including CPU-Z and HWMonitor. Their thorough knowledge of system health helps to enable focused repairs and maintenance. Accurate diagnosis requires these instruments.

Data Recovery Tools

Retreading lost or corrupted files from failed hard disks depends on data recovery software such as Recuva and EaseUS Data Recovery Wizard. They guarantee that priceless knowledge is kept by helping to retrieve vital data that could otherwise be lost.

Operating System Installation Media

Rebinning or updating the OS depends on having the right operational system installation media. This media guarantees that the laptop can run the most recent updates and patches, therefore enhancing its general stability and performance.

Sourcing Parts for Legacy Laptops

Finding Replacement Parts

Legacy laptop replacement components are readily available on online markets such eBay and Amazon. These sites can be quite helpful in locating particular parts that can be challenging elsewhere. Before you buy, always check the seller’s standing.

Specialized repair facilities may carry parts for older models and concentrate on legacy technologies. These stores can provide skilled repair guidance in addition to uncommon or hard-to-found components. They provide consistently reliable access to required components.

One cheap approach to get required components is to recycle parts from old or broken computers. Extensive spares for repairs can come from extracting useable components from non-functional equipment. Make that the recovered components are in good enough shape for use.

Verifying the Compatibility of Parts

Check that replacement components fit the model number and specs of the laptop. Ensuring compatibility guarantees that the components would operate as expected with the laptop and helps to avoid problems. Good repairs depend on this stage.

For thorough compatibility information, refer to the manufacturer’s specifications. This guarantees that any updates or replacement parts fit the particular laptop model in issue. Manufacturer instructions prevent possible compatibility issues.

FAQs

What is a legacy-tech laptop?  

An older model that the manufacturer might no longer support is known as a legacy-tech laptop. Both amateurs and experts will find these laptops a special difficulty since they sometimes need particular know-how or parts for repair and maintenance.

Can all legacy laptops be repaired? 

Although many old computers can be fixed, the viability relies on the availability of components and the particular problem under hand. It’s important to assess the condition and possible expenses since some older models could be too obsolete for reasonably priced repairs.

Where can I find parts for an old laptop?  

Old laptop parts can usually be found online markets, specialized electronics retailers, or by means of recycling facilities. A great source is also local repair shops, who may have suitable components or be able to order them especially for your need.

Is it worth repairing an old laptop? 

If the cost is far less than purchasing new and the laptop still satisfies your needs, then fixing an old one can be well worth it. But given current software and applications, specifically, it’s crucial to take performance restrictions into account and how they could affect your use.

How do I know if my old laptop can run modern software? 

Check the minimum system requirements of current software against your old laptop’s specs to see whether it can run modern programs. Running a performance test can also help ascertain whether an upgrade is required to raise compatibility and functioning.
